Rajaratnam v. United States of America

Filing 13

MEMORANDUM OPINION AND ORDER: For the foregoing reasons, the Court resolves the various outstanding motions and requests in the following manner: 1. The motion to correct, vacate, and/or set aside his sentence pursuant to Title 28, United States Code , Section2255 [dkt. no. 354] and the request for oral argument [dkt. no. 366] are denied. 2. The writ of error coram nobis to vacate, reassess, and amend his order of forfeiture [dkt. no. 351] and the request for oral argument [dkt. no. 367] are denied. (Signed by Judge Loretta A. Preska on 3/3/2017) (jwh) Modified on 3/3/2017 (jwh).
